3×3 Dirty Man Makers- Manmaker with 3 hand release merkins at the bottom and 3 squat thrusters at the top.

Fully warmed up PAX moved onto Thang 1:

M.E.R.C.Y. High Fives
Done with FIVE stations at the bottom of a hill. The hill climb and distance is your challenge. PAX must complete each station’s circuit at the top of the hill before moving to the next. All stations (except the C-Crawl Station have a WO at the top of the hill which start with 1 Rep and ascend up to 5 Reps before that station’s circuit is complete.
Station 1 – M – Manmakers w/ ruck –
Station 2 – E – Squat w/ Extension- Squat with overhead lift of Ruck
Station 3 – R – Rock-a-Bye Babies w/Ruck
Station 4 – C – Crawl (aka Bear Crawl) w/Ruck
Station 5 – Y – Yoke Walk w/ Sandbag At the top of the hill, complete the required number of ascending Squats
Lord Have MERCY on your muscles after you climb HIGH up the hill FIVE times for FIVE sets.

With the growing numbers, YHC felt it was time to spend a few minutes on how to Q and properly call cadence so that everyone is on the same page moving forward with workouts.

Warm-O-Rama:

We started off reviewing the disclaimer, as well as the 5 principles of F3.

Disclaimer:

Welcome to F3, this is a free, volunteer, peer-led workout. I am not a professional. I have no knowledge of any injuries or fitness considerations. It is each person’s responsibility to be safe and modify exercises if you need to. We all do it, most important thing is that you don’t get hurt.

5 Principles of F3:

  • Be free of charge
  • Be open to all men
  • Be held outdoors, rain or shine, heat or cold
  • Be led by men who participate in the workout in a rotating fashion, with no training or certification necessary
  • End with a Circle of Trust

We then covered the importance of and how to call cadence. The workout today demonstrated various different types of cadence to show it is not all one size fits all.

Counting Cadence:

  • Creates rhythm which distracts the mind from the task at hand
  • Builds teamwork by synchronizing PAX and creating focus
  • Not knowing the number of reps discourages budgeting of effort; you get used to going as long as you have to

Proper Cadence Sequence:

  • “The next exercise is…” [pause] “Side Straddle Hop!” (or name of other exercise) – PAX REPEAT BACK!
  • “Starting Position…” [pause] “Move!”
  • “In Cadence…” [pause] “Exercise!” (begin count 1..2..3)
